The Staffing and Labor Economics Facing Santa Clara Consumer Services

Operating in the Bay Area presents a unique set of labor challenges for the consumer services and venue sector. With wage inflation consistently outpacing national averages, operators are under immense pressure to control costs while maintaining high-quality service. According to recent industry reports, labor accounts for over 40% of total operating expenses for large-scale venues in California. Compounding this is a persistent talent shortage, making it difficult to staff peak event periods without incurring significant overtime or premium pay. The reliance on manual labor for routine tasks like crowd monitoring and guest support has become a structural liability. AI-driven automation offers a path to decouple service capacity from headcount, allowing operators to scale operations without a linear increase in payroll costs, effectively insulating the business from the volatility of the local labor market.

VenueNext at a glance

What we know about VenueNext

What they do

Until now, it hasn't been easy to harness the collective power of solitary systems. Today, VenueNext is bringing unprecedented integration to both existing and new systems to amplify all that venues have to offer their guests. From sports to concerts, conferences to theme parks, and all large venues in between, the VenueNext technology platform and context-aware app provides deeper insight into guest behavior, and ultimate control over your entire ecosystem. VenueNext debuted in 2014 at the first home season game of the San Francisco 49ers at Levi's Stadium. Our team of experienced technical developers has worked for many great ventures including Google, Facebook, Dish Networks, Sling Media, AOL, Netscape and Oracle. Based in San Francisco, Silicon Valley, and New York, we thrive on solving the most difficult physical / digital integration challenges for venues.

Autonomous Guest Flow and Crowd Management Optimization

Large-scale venues in California face immense pressure to maintain safety and throughput during peak congestion. Manual oversight of crowd density is reactive and prone to human error. By shifting to AI-driven monitoring, operators can predict bottlenecks before they manifest. This reduces the risk of safety incidents, lowers the need for excessive on-site security staffing, and ensures a seamless experience. For a regional multi-site operator like VenueNext, standardizing these protocols across different geographic locations ensures consistent service quality while managing the high labor costs inherent in the Bay Area market.

The agent ingests real-time sensor and ticketing data to predict crowd density. It dynamically updates digital signage, directs staff to high-traffic areas, and adjusts queue management logic in the VenueNext app. By autonomously triggering rerouting instructions to guests, the agent balances load distribution across venue gates and concessions, ensuring optimal flow without human intervention.

Energy and Sustainability Resource Management

California’s stringent environmental regulations and high energy costs necessitate efficient utility management. Venues are massive energy consumers, and manual control of lighting, climate, and water systems is rarely optimal. AI agents can synchronize energy usage with event schedules and real-time occupancy data, significantly reducing the carbon footprint and operational utility expenses. This proactive management not only helps with regulatory compliance but also supports corporate sustainability goals, which are increasingly important to both investors and venue stakeholders.

The agent integrates with the venue’s building management system (BMS). It adjusts lighting and HVAC settings based on real-time occupancy sensors and the event schedule. By learning the thermal inertia of the venue, it optimizes start/stop times for climate control, ensuring guest comfort while preventing energy waste in unoccupied zones.
